package control
import (
"errors"
"fmt"
"gvisor.dev/gvisor/pkg/eventchannel"
"gvisor.dev/gvisor/pkg/urpc"
)
// EventsOpts are the arguments for eventchannel-related commands.
type EventsOpts struct {
urpc.FilePayload
}
// Events is the control server state for eventchannel-related commands.
type Events struct {
emitter eventchannel.Emitter
}
// AttachDebugEmitter receives a connected unix domain socket FD from the client
// and establishes it as a new emitter for the sentry eventchannel. Any existing
// emitters are replaced on a subsequent attach.
func (e *Events) AttachDebugEmitter(o *EventsOpts, _ *struct{}) error {
if len(o.FilePayload.Files) < 1 {
return errors.New("no output writer provided")
}
sock, err := o.ReleaseFD(0)
if err != nil {
return err
}
sockFD := sock.Release()
// SocketEmitter takes ownership of sockFD.
emitter, err := eventchannel.SocketEmitter(sockFD)
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("failed to create SocketEmitter for FD %d: %v", sockFD, err)
}
// If there is already a debug emitter, close the old one.
if e.emitter != nil {
e.emitter.Close()
}
e.emitter = eventchannel.DebugEmitterFrom(emitter)
// Register the new stream destination.
eventchannel.AddEmitter(e.emitter)
return nil
}
